Hi Hristo,

You might want to look into the  extension point  
org.eclipse.ui.navigator.navigatorContent  in the plugin 
org.eclipse.jst.j2ee.navigator.ui, 
also look at the various Item Providers classes such as WebAppItemProvider
.

I'm improving the Deployment Descriptor subtree in project tree of Web 2.4 
projects. But I have problem with understanding the structure and how it 
works. Can somebody help me with description how nodes are added to this 
tree when new one artefact is created in the web.xml file?
Originaly in this tree have group nodes: Filter Mapping, Filters, 
Listener, References, Security, Servlet Mappings and Servlets.
So, first I'm wondering is it possible these group nodes to become more 
dynamic. E.g. when they are empty to be removed from the tree, and to 
appear when first child node is added.
